Earnings Yield vs Dividend Yield

Yields show how much you are getting for the price you pay. For example, an earnings yield of 8% means that for every dollar you pay, you get 8 cents worth of current earnings. Take these numbers into account when buying to see if you are over-paying or getting a good deal.

Earnings Yield 7.15%
Dividend Yield 2.83%

Efficent Use of Assets

Profit margins show what percentage of every dollar of sales turns into earnings. Asset Uitlization shows how many dollars of sales a company gets for each dollar that the company invests in assets. Multiplying the two numbers together gives you Return on Assets which tells you approximately how efficiently the company invests money to earn more money.

Profit Margin 9.12%
Asset Utilization 1.326

Reinvestment Strategy

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) tells you how much income a company earned after investing $1 in its business. The Payout Ratio tells what percentage of the company's income it pays to shareholders instead of reinvesting in its own growth. Watch out for companies that pay out very little when their ROIC is low.

5 Year Average ROIC 0.1697
5 Year Average Payout Ratio 0.3459
